Steve Kabba
Steve Kabba will be returning to Palace after his three-month loan period at Grimsby ends next month.
Grimsby Town boss Paul Groves wanted to keep Kabba until the end of the season, but Trevor Francis wants the striker to return after the three months is up.
Kabba said: "Trevor Francis has already told me he wants me back at Palace when the loan is up. I would have liked to stay here but that's not in my hands.
"I will do my best while I'm here but it appears as though that will be that - unless the gaffer changes his mind."
Kabba has scored only once since his move to Blundell Park, although he has been a hit with the fans, for his energetic performances.
